In 1959 Dr. Fred M. Barlow was elected National Sunday school consultant
for Regular Baptist Press and the General Association of Regular Baptist
Churches. He held pastorates in New York, Ohio and Michigan.
Then
he began a ministry to local churches and multi-church Sunday school
conferences; held evangelistic campaigns; gave addresses to Bible
colleges and seminaries; and was active in summer Bible camp evangelism
and youth rallies. His sermons have been prize winners in sermon contests
held by the Sword of the Lord.
He
was the author of several books, including: Vitalizing Your Sunday School
Visitation, Special Days in the Sunday School, Timeless Truths, Profiles in Evangelism...Revival for Survival...and
several smaller booklets, including a biography of John R. Rice.
Dr.
Barlow was a native of southeastern West Virginia. He graduated from
Baptist Bible Seminary (now Baptist Bible College of Pennsylvania, Clarks
Summit, Pennsylvania) and received an honorary Doctor of Divinity degree
from Western Baptist Bible
College, Salem, Oregon.
Dr. and Mrs. Barlow were parents of four children. Dr. Barlow died in
1983.
